Seniors in a nursing home would appreciate Warren, Ohio, for its vibrant community resources that cater to their needs. The Trumbull County Senior Services, located nearby, offers a variety of programs ranging from meal delivery to social activities that foster connection and engagement. The Warren Community Center boasts recreational facilities specifically designed for older adults, ensuring they can stay active and socialize with peers. Additionally, the nearby Packard Park features accessible walking trails and serene picnic areas, perfect for outdoor relaxation and leisurely strolls. These amenities create an inviting atmosphere for seniors seeking a fulfilling lifestyle.

Resources for seniors in Warren, OH
Direction Home of Eastern Ohio is a dedicated nonprofit organization located in Warren, OH, that focuses on enhancing the independence of seniors by providing a range of free or low-cost services and supports. With programs such as PASSPORT and the Ohio Home Care Waiver, Direction Home offers alternatives to nursing home care, ensuring that seniors can remain comfortably in their own homes. The agency also plays a vital role in coordinating MyCare Ohio and offering essential caregiver support services. Additionally, it operates a long-term care ombudsman program aimed at advocating for the rights and well-being of seniors, whether they are living at home, within the community, or in nursing facilities. For more information, you can reach them at (800) 686-7367.
The Trumbull County Senior Levy Services operates the Warren SCOPE Senior Center, located in Warren, OH. This center is dedicated to supporting seniors by providing essential aging-related information and referral services. The knowledgeable staff at the SCOPE Senior Center coordinates various services, including case management, personal care, chore assistance, and prescription support. Additionally, the center offers a range of social activities designed to enrich the lives of individuals aging at home. For more information or assistance, seniors can contact the center at (330) 399-8846.
ProSeniors is a dedicated legal helpline based in Warren, OH, specifically designed to assist Ohio residents aged 60 and older, irrespective of their financial circumstances. Through this valuable service, seniors can access expert guidance on essential topics such as Medicare, Medicaid, durable powers of attorney for health care, and living wills. The compassionate attorneys at ProSeniors work closely with clients to ensure their legal matters are addressed until they reach resolution or are referred to another program offering discounted assistance. By prioritizing the legal needs of seniors, ProSeniors plays a crucial role in empowering older adults to navigate the complexities of healthcare law and ensure their rights are protected. For support, seniors can reach out by calling (513) 345-4160.
Trumbull County Veteran Services, located in Warren, OH, provides essential support to veterans and their families by offering assistance with accessing benefits and entitlements. With a team of trained professionals on hand, the organization guides eligible individuals through the complexities of securing various services, including provisions that may help cover the costs associated with long-term care, such as nursing home accommodations. For help and more information, you can reach them at (330) 675-2585.
Considerations for seniors living in Warren, OH
Affordable living: The cost of living in Warren is lower than the national average, making it affordable for seniors on a fixed income.
Access to healthcare: Warren has several hospitals and medical centers that offer quality healthcare services to seniors.
Leisure activities: There are plenty of recreational facilities and opportunities for seniors to keep themselves entertained and active. Parks, golf courses, and community centers are just some examples of available options.
Community involvement: Seniors can get involved in various community organizations and clubs, allowing them to socialize with their peers and contribute to the community.
Public transportation: Warren also has a reliable public transportation system that makes it easy for seniors to get around the city without owning a car.
Cultural attractions: Warren has a diverse range of cultural attractions such as museums, art galleries, historical landmarks, and theaters that can appeal to seniors with different interests.
Supportive senior services: The city has various senior programs and resources such as elder abuse hotlines, caregiver support groups, home care services among others aimed at assisting aging residents aged above 60 years.
